To ensure the success of your custom data integration project, mastering the ten essential steps in a successful custom data integration project is paramount. From defining clear project goals to monitoring system performance, each step plays a vital role in achieving optimal outcomes. By understanding and implementing these crucial steps, you can pave the way for a seamless and efficient data integration process.
Define Your Goals
When embarking on a custom data integration project, the initial step is to define your goals clearly and precisely. Goal alignment is crucial to ensure that all aspects of the project work towards the same objectives. Start by outlining the project scope, detailing what data needs to be integrated, and the desired outcomes. This will help in setting a clear direction and avoiding scope creep.
Stakeholder buy-in is essential for the success of the project. Engage with key stakeholders early on to gather their input and ensure their needs are considered in the goal-setting process. Clearly communicate the benefits of the project and how it aligns with the overall business objectives to secure their support.
Establishing success metrics is vital to track progress and evaluate the project’s effectiveness. Define key performance indicators (KPIs) that align with your goals and regularly monitor them to ensure the project is on track. By setting clear goals, gaining stakeholder buy-in, and defining success metrics, you lay a solid foundation for a successful custom data integration project.
Choose the Right Tool
After defining your project goals and ensuring stakeholder buy-in, the next critical step is selecting the right tool for your custom data integration project. Begin by conducting a thorough tool evaluation process. Consider factors such as the tool’s compatibility with your existing systems, scalability, ease of use, and support for the specific data formats you will be working with.
During the tool evaluation, pay close attention to how each option addresses potential implementation challenges. Look for tools that offer robust features for data mapping, transformation, and scheduling to streamline the integration process. Consider the learning curve for your team and the availability of training resources provided by the tool vendor.
Implementation challenges such as data mapping complexities, connectivity issues, and ensuring data security can be mitigated by choosing a tool that aligns with your project requirements. By selecting the right tool through a comprehensive evaluation process, you can set a strong foundation for a successful custom data integration project.
Set Up Data Quality Procedures
To ensure the success of your custom data integration project, it is crucial to establish robust data quality procedures. Data validation is a key aspect of ensuring that the information being integrated is accurate, complete, and consistent. Implement automated checks at various stages of the integration process to catch any discrepancies or anomalies promptly. These automated checks can help identify errors such as missing data, duplicate entries, or formatting issues, allowing you to address them before they impact the overall quality of the integrated data.
Setting up data quality procedures involves defining clear validation rules and criteria that the data must meet to be considered of high quality. Regularly monitor and review the results of the automated checks to identify any recurring issues or patterns that may indicate underlying problems with the data sources. By establishing effective data quality procedures, you can enhance the reliability and integrity of your integrated data, ultimately leading to better decision-making and outcomes for your project.
Ensure Data Security
To safeguard the confidentiality and integrity of your data throughout the custom data integration project, it is imperative to prioritize and implement robust data security measures. Utilizing encryption methods is crucial in ensuring that sensitive information remains secure. By encrypting data in transit and at rest, you add an extra layer of protection against unauthorized access. Implementing access controls is also essential. By setting up role-based access permissions, you can restrict data access to only those who require it for their specific tasks, reducing the risk of data breaches.
When selecting encryption methods, consider using industry-standard algorithms such as AES (Advanced Encryption Standard) for securing your data. Additionally, implement multi-factor authentication to strengthen access controls further. Regularly monitor and update these security measures to stay ahead of potential threats and vulnerabilities that may arise during the custom data integration project. By prioritizing data security through encryption methods and access controls, you can mitigate risks and ensure the confidentiality of your data.
Plan for Scalability
When planning for scalability in your custom data integration project, it’s crucial to consider scalability considerations and growth projection planning. Assessing how your system can handle increased data loads and user traffic is essential for long-term success. By proactively planning for scalability, you can ensure that your data integration project can grow seamlessly with your business needs.
Scalability Considerations
Considering the future growth and expanding needs of your organization, it is imperative to address scalability considerations within your custom data integration project. Performance optimization plays a crucial role in ensuring that your integrated system can handle increasing data volumes efficiently. By fine-tuning processes and utilizing appropriate technologies, you can enhance the overall performance of your data integration solution.
Resource allocation is another key aspect to consider when planning for scalability. Allocate resources such as processing power, memory, and storage effectively to accommodate future growth without compromising system performance. This involves analyzing current resource usage patterns and forecasting future requirements to scale your infrastructure accordingly.
Furthermore, implementing scalability best practices, such as load balancing and horizontal scaling, can help distribute workloads evenly across your system, preventing bottlenecks during peak usage periods. By proactively addressing scalability considerations in your custom data integration project, you can build a robust and flexible system that can grow seamlessly alongside your organization’s evolving needs.
Growth Projection Planning
Addressing scalability in your custom data integration project involves forward-thinking strategies to accommodate the growth and evolving needs of your organization. Growth projection planning is essential for ensuring that your data integration system can handle increased data volumes and complexity as your business expands. Revenue forecasting and market analysis are crucial components of growth projection planning. By analyzing market trends and predicting revenue streams, you can better prepare your data integration system for future needs. Strategic planning plays a key role in growth projection, as it helps align your data integration project with the long-term goals of your organization.
Data visualization tools can aid in projecting growth by providing clear insights into your data and helping you identify patterns and trends. By visualizing data, you can make more informed decisions regarding scalability and resource allocation. Incorporating growth projection planning into your custom data integration project ensures that your system can adapt to the changing demands of your business, ultimately leading to a more successful integration process.
Setup Real-time Integration
To effectively set up real-time integration for your custom data project, begin by ensuring your data sources are capable of providing continuous updates. Data synchronization is crucial in real-time integration to ensure that changes made in one system are promptly reflected in others. Integration challenges may arise due to the need for reliable and fast communication between various data sources. It is essential to choose integration tools and technologies that support real-time data transfer efficiently.
When setting up real-time integration, consider the volume of data being transferred and the frequency of updates required. Implement monitoring mechanisms to track the performance of your real-time integration processes and promptly address any issues that may arise. Testing the integration thoroughly before deployment is vital to ensure that data flows seamlessly and accurately in real-time. By carefully planning and executing the setup of real-time integration, you can enhance the efficiency and effectiveness of your custom data project.
Handle Different Data Formats
When handling different data formats in your custom data integration project, understanding the diverse structures and types of data is key to seamless integration. Data transformation plays a crucial role in ensuring format compatibility across various sources. Begin by identifying the specific formats your project needs to support, such as CSV, XML, JSON, or proprietary formats. Utilize data mapping techniques to convert these formats into a unified structure that your system can process effectively. Consider using tools like ETL (Extract, Transform, Load) processes to automate the conversion process and streamline the integration of disparate data formats. Validate the transformed data to ensure accuracy and consistency before merging it with your existing datasets. By paying close attention to data transformation and format compatibility, you can enhance the efficiency and accuracy of your custom data integration project.
Set up Error Handling Procedures
When dealing with a custom data integration project, establishing robust error handling procedures is essential for maintaining data integrity and system reliability. Exception handling plays a crucial role in identifying and managing errors that may arise during the integration process. By implementing a structured approach to exception handling, you can quickly pinpoint issues and prevent data corruption.
Effective error resolution mechanisms are equally important in ensuring the smooth functioning of your data integration project. Properly documenting errors, categorizing them based on severity, and defining clear resolution steps can streamline the troubleshooting process. This proactive approach minimizes downtime and helps in resolving issues promptly.
Regularly reviewing and updating error handling procedures are vital to adapt to evolving data integration requirements and address new challenges effectively. By continuously refining your error handling strategies, you can enhance the overall reliability and efficiency of your data integration system. Remember, a well-structured error handling framework is a cornerstone of a successful custom data integration project.
Train Users
Three key components are essential for successful implementation of a custom data integration project, and one of them involves training users effectively. User engagement plays a crucial role in ensuring the success of a data integration project. To achieve this, it is important to design training sessions that are engaging and interactive. By involving users in the learning process, you can increase their understanding of the new system and encourage their active participation.
Training effectiveness is another critical aspect to focus on. Tailoring training sessions to the specific needs and roles of different user groups can enhance their learning experience. Providing hands-on practice opportunities and real-life scenarios can help users grasp the concepts more effectively. Regular feedback sessions and assessments can also gauge the effectiveness of the training and identify areas that may need further clarification.
Monitor and Optimize
To ensure the ongoing success of your custom data integration project, it is imperative to continually monitor and optimize the system. Monitoring progress is crucial in identifying any bottlenecks, errors, or inefficiencies that may arise during the integration process. By closely monitoring the data flow, you can quickly address any issues that may impact the project’s timeline or accuracy.
Optimizing performance involves fine-tuning the integration system to ensure it operates at its best capacity. This includes adjusting configurations, enhancing data mapping, and refining data transformation processes. By optimizing the system, you can improve data accuracy, reduce processing times, and enhance overall efficiency.
Regularly reviewing and analyzing system performance metrics is essential for making informed decisions on how to best optimize your custom data integration project. By staying proactive and attentive to the system’s performance, you can ensure that your project continues to meet its objectives effectively.
Frequently Asked Questions
How Can We Effectively Handle Data Conflicts During Integration?
When handling data conflicts during integration, utilize conflict resolution strategies like prioritizing data sources and involving stakeholders. Implement data mapping techniques to align disparate data formats. Ensure clear communication and documentation to resolve conflicts efficiently.
What Are the Best Practices for Maintaining Data Integrity Post-Integration?
To maintain data integrity post-integration, ensure rigorous data validation processes are in place. Regularly perform data synchronization checks to identify discrepancies and promptly address any issues. This proactive approach will help uphold the accuracy and consistency of your data.
How Do We Ensure Compatibility With Future Software Updates?
To future proof your integration, ensure compatibility with software updates by using flexible data formats, documenting all changes meticulously, and regularly testing systems post-update. Stay agile to adapt swiftly to evolving software requirements.
What Measures Should Be Taken to Prevent Data Leakage?
To prevent data leakage, you must implement robust prevention measures. Enhance data security through encryption, access controls, and regular audits. Stay vigilant for vulnerabilities and promptly address any potential breaches to safeguard sensitive information effectively.
How Can We Measure the ROI of the Data Integration Project?
To measure ROI in your data integration project, assess cost savings, revenue increase, and productivity gains. Overcome integration challenges by tracking KPIs, setting clear objectives, and aligning with business goals for effective ROI analysis.